About the trip to St. Petersburg

I went to St. Petersburg spontaneously, the decision caught up with me (there was a reason which I will not name). And here I am at the station with a bag already ready for the trip, I enter the carriage of the old train and get into another world. Unfamiliar people around, the smell of doshik, the clatter of car wheels against the joints of rails, rocking. The first night of the trip was nothing, I didn't realize what I was experiencing. Wet dreams on arrival in St. Petersburg, or the stress of not being at home in my own bed? By the way I slept on the top seats - it's hell where you can't roll over properly.

After spending 2 days on the road, shaking in the train, I ate fast food and drank water. On arrival in St. Petersburg my eyes saw the indescribable beauty of the city. It has everything! This architecture absorbed me, I even thought about a full-fledged move for further life, I really liked Peter! In the beginning, arriving at the central Moscow station, you immediately enter Nevsky, meeting the stella on the square.

By the way, I have already been to St. Petersburg a few years ago, but then I didn't realize myself fully what? I did not care about these houses with patterns and frescoes. Perhaps it was my age or circumstances.

The center of St. Petersburg

Oh yes! It's something! Bridges, palaces of royal families, narrow streets with incredible buildings, cruiser Aurora, cathedrals, temples and squares. All these buildings here are realized to the fullest, the center of St. Petersburg on the level of European cities.

From the transport side it is hard here, the narrow avenues of St. Petersburg just can't cope, traffic jams are huge (I haven't seen such things even in Moscow).

Cars, by the way, here are exclusively above average - it can be a luxury Maybach or M5 F90, and if it will be a Zhigul or some Granta, the Zhigul will be in perfect condition, and the Granta is just like a car for an employee of some company.

St. Petersburg is next to Finland because of this you can often see license plates on cars from that country. The subway, yes, in St. Petersburg it is awesome! The cars are certainly not new, but the very essence that the subway stations in this historic capital are among the deepest in the world - it's cool.
